We’re looking for a Early Years Regional Administrator. This role is for a regional administrator, supporting the region expected to travel to all nurseries within the Leeds area. This is a part time role, 20 hours per week.
As an Early Years Administrator, you will lead parent outreach initiatives, supporting the manager with new nursery places, extra sessions, and booking changes. You will assist parents with financial queries and solutions, and coordinate monthly invoice runs, invoice debt, funding tasks, and manage payment plans. When required, you will also support the nursery manager with ad hoc administrative tasks and reports.
